Prince William Faces ‘Ultimate Test’ From King Charles as Future Monarch

The monarch reportedly believes healing the rift with Harry is part of proving royal leadership

King Charles is said to be placing a difficult expectation on his eldest son as he prepares him for the responsibilities of the throne.

According to royal insiders, the monarch believes the Prince of Wales must face what some have described as a “brutal, ultimate test” to demonstrate he is ready for the future role of king.

Sources speaking to Radar Online claim the challenge centres on the ongoing family rift between William and his younger brother, Harry. The divide within the royal family has remained unresolved for several years and continues to attract public attention.

Insiders suggest the situation has become a growing concern for the King, who reportedly hopes for some form of reconciliation between his sons despite the deep tensions surrounding the Duke of Sussex and Meghan Markle.

Within palace circles, it is said there is a strong belief that Charles views a potential reunion with Harry as a significant measure of William’s leadership. According to one source, the King sees the effort to rebuild family unity as part of preparing the Prince of Wales for the throne.

The insider explained that Charles believes demonstrating unity within the family is important for the monarchy’s long-term stability. Because of that, he reportedly feels William must show he can rise above personal grievances if the situation requires it.

Sources also claim the King no longer believes the divide will simply heal with time. Instead, he reportedly sees the situation as a defining moment for William as he moves closer to becoming monarch.

From Charles’s perspective, the matter is less about family disagreement and more about leadership. Insiders say he expects William to put royal duty ahead of personal feelings and focus on what he believes is best for the institution.

According to those familiar with the discussions, the message from the King is clear: future leadership of the monarchy will require the ability to separate emotion from responsibility and take a long-term view of the crown’s future.
